Slayer saying goodbye with One Final World Tour

Earlier this year Slayer announced that it would do one last concert tour around the globe to thank their fans for all of their support over the past 37 years. Slayer has made some of the most brutal, breathtakingly aggressive, all-hell’s-breaking-loose music ever created, and being the band that other heavy acts measured against and aspire to. The band’s membership in “The Big Four” along with Metallica, Megadeath, and Anthrax are the bands that defined the trash metal genre and forever remembered for their accomplishments in music history.

Lamb of God, Anthrax, Behemoth and Testament have supported Slayer on the first leg of its final world tour; however, they lose Behemoth but add Napalm Death during the second leg of the world tour. The band has also announced dates in the UK and Europe for October and November. That being said France’s Hellfest festival has just announced that Slayer will be headlining their event in June of 2019. 

Slayer has released 12 studio albums, multiple live recordings, live video and two box sets, played nearly 3000 concerts worldwide, five Grammy nominations and two Grammy awards, Gold records, and they have its own exhibit in the Smithsonian Institute.

The Slayer Final World Tour landed in Orlando, FL and fed the sold-out crowd a heavy dose of metal madness that shook the Orlando Amphitheatre.
